In 2015 a population of a small town in Florida is 95. If the population increases by 15% every year, approximately how many people will there be in 2023

Respuesta :

youdaso123 youdaso123
  • 03-02-2018
P = 95(1.15/1)^1(8)

P = 290 population rounded down because you can't have part of a person
